Alahalli Population - Bijapur, Karnataka
Alahalli is a medium size village located in Sindgi Taluka of Bijapur district, Karnataka with total 225 families residing. The Alahalli village has population of 1499 of which 787 are males while 712 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Alahalli village population of children with age 0-6 is 232 which makes up 15.48 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Alahalli village is 905 which is lower than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Alahalli as per census is 744, lower than Karnataka average of 948.
Alahalli village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Alahalli village was 69.22 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Alahalli Male literacy stands at 82.57 % while female literacy rate was 54.98 %.
